The Dengie D-Caf continues to remain a small, local charity that is volunteer led and run. We have no paid staff. The Chair co-ordinates the sessions and the volunteers.

We continued our quarterly trustee meetings with treasurer reports and quarterly volunteers’ meetings to organise social activities and use for staff training. We were also successful in applying for a grant from a local organisation to assist with transporting members to and from sessions. Many had lost confidence driving since diagnosis and a few had surrendered their driving license due to deterioration of dementia. Local transport is very poor, so a £1500 grant was awarded and 6 volunteer drivers recruited from current team. The grant funded DBS checks, plus the standard HMRC recommendation of 45p per mile.

The Chair continues to report back on the sessions at trustee meetings and trustees continue to approve decisions outside trustee meetings, Jane English continues her role as lead trustee and Chair will seek approval or advice in-between meetings as and when necessary.

We increased the numbers of our volunteers due to our membership steadily increasing throughout the year. We now have a team of 17 volunteers. The Chair continues to promote the WhatsApp group for volunteers and for Members. This helps with communication and is used to remind about upcoming sessions and news and to wish people Happy Birthday when required. Carers have stated that they find the WhatsApp group a great source of support if they are struggling and for sharing advice and tips from others in a similar situation.

C. Objectives & Activities

Dengie D-Caf aims to promote a good quality of life by supporting people living with dementia, their carers, family and friends.

Dengie D-Caf dementia support group members normally meet on the 2[nd] Wednesday and, due to our membership expanding, we increased our sessions to include 4[th] Thursday of every month in a larger venue. We also decided to continue with our Steeple session on first Friday of each month as this venue is more rural and provides services to the more remote and isolated part of our area. It also has different types of facilities such as WIFI and a large indoor bowls mat, plus secure outside space, which facilitated a lovely summer picnic. Our members also felt that because our Steeple session had a smaller number of attendees, it was perfect for regular reminiscing work, which is always very well received. Activities continue to be chosen by members to ensure we meet their needs and aspirations. Also learning new skills where possible. Carers frequently say how therapeutic our craft activities are.

Our main aim for Dengie D-Caf is to provide a safe, welcoming space and to actively listen and engage with all members. Activities are chosen by the group to reflect their interests and histories and to promote living well with dementia. We provide support and information to carers as well as to those living with dementia. Carers who are sadly bereaved are also encouraged to keep attending for friendship and as support for others. Due to the increased number of volunteers, our more experienced

volunteers sit with members at each session and chat about their month and actively listen to identify anyone who may be struggling.

Our regular visitors from Alzheimer’s society and local police help us to meet aims to offer advice and information to our members that is relevant and up to date.

Our monthly newsletters include photographs of the previous session, birthdays, local news and events, plus a monthly quiz to do in the session if time permits, or at home. They also include dementia-related features, e.g., benefit advice, health related topics and articles to maintain independence at home for carers and helpful information to increase wellbeing for those living at home with dementia. Our WhatsApp group helps with effective communication in between sessions as well as a support mechanism for carers.
